Clinical Setting of Neutropenia-Febrile-High-Risk

  • Febrile neutropenia: Post-cancer chemotherapy or post-allogeneic bone marrow transplant patient with fever (≥38.3°C x 1 hr of sustained over 38°C) AND neutropenic (absolute neutrophil count range from <500-<1000 cells/μL)
  • High risk: Inpatient status at time of development of fever, significant medical comorbidity or clinically unstable, anticipated neutropenia of ≤100 cells/μL and ≥ 7 days, hepatic or renal insufficiency, uncontrolled/progressive cancer, pneumonia or other complex infections, mucositis grade 3-4, MASCC Risk Index score of < 21, Alemtuzumab.
